Frieda Elsa Daniels 1896–1978 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 28 Jul 1896

Birth Location: Germany

Death Date: 21 May 1978

Death Location: Milwaukee County, Wisconsin, USA

Father: Bruno Daniels

Mother: Anna Dorfler

Spouse(s): Otto Schramm

Children(s): Horst Schramm

Frieda Elsa Daniels was born in 1896 in Germany, the child of Bruno J Daniels And Anna M Dorfler. Frieda Elsa Daniels married Otto Paul Wilhelm Schramm, and had children including Horst Alfred Schramm. Frieda Elsa Daniels passed away in 1978 in Milwaukee County, Wisconsin, USA.
